VESSEL NO.: Burial 4, Vessel 29; 2003.08.0725

NON-PLASTICS AND PASTE: grog; fine sandy paste

VESSEL FORM: Carinated bowl

RIM AND LIP FORM: Direct rim and rounded lip

CORE COLOR: H (fired in a reducing environment and cooled in the open air)

INTERIOR SURFACE COLOR: yellowish-brown; fire clouds on the rim, body, and base

EXTERIOR SURFACE COLOR: dark grayish-brown

WALL THICKNESS (RIM, BODY, AND BASE IN MM): rim, 8.6 mm

INTERIOR SURFACE TREATMENT: smoothed

EXTERIOR SURFACE TREATMENT: smoothed

HEIGHT (IN CM): 13.0

ORIFICE DIAMETER (IN CM): 26.2

DIAMETER AT BOTTOM OF RIM OR NECK (IN CM): 23.5

BASE DIAMETER (IN CM) AND SHAPE OF BASE: 9.0; circular and flat

ESTIMATED VOLUME (IN LITERS): 2.04

DECORATION (INCLUDING MOTIF AND ELEMENTS WHEN APPARENT): The rim panel has an engraved slanted scroll motif, repeated four times around the vessel, that ends in upper and lower hooked arm elements. The scrolls are divided by vertical brackets with two inner spur-like projections. The scroll fill zones have vertical and curvilinear engraved lines.

PIGMENT USE AND LOCATION ON VESSEL: none

TYPE AND VARIETY [IF KNOWN]: Taylor Engraved

Taylor Engraved carinated bowl, Enis Smith cemetery, Burial 4, Vessel 29.
